Subject: [PATCH] x86/vdso: implement clock_gettime(C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W, ...)

Add C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W to the existing clock_gettime() vDSO
implementation. This is based on the ideas of Jason Vas Dias and comments
of Thomas Gleixner.
---- Test code ----
#include <errno.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<time.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#define CLOCK_TYPE C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W
#define DURATION_SEC 10
int main(int argc, char **argv)
{
struct timespec t, end;
unsigned long long cnt = 0;
clock_gettime(CLOCK_TYPE, &end);
end.tv_sec += DURATION_SEC;
do {
clock_gettime(CLOCK_TYPE, &t);
++cnt;
} while (t.tv_sec < end.tv_sec || t.tv_nsec < end.tv_nsec);
dprintf(STDOUT_FILENO, "%llu", cnt);
return EXIT_SUCCESS;
}
-------------------
The results from the above test program:
Clock Before After Diff
----- ------ ----- ----
CLOCK_MONOTONIC 355531720 338039373 -5%
C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W 44831738 336064912 +650%
CLOCK_REALTIME 347665133 338102907 -3%

arch/x86/entry/vdso/vclock_gettime.c | 11 +++++++++--
arch/x86/entry/vsyscall/vsyscall_gtod.c | 6 ++++++
arch/x86/include/asm/vgtod.h | 5 ++++-
3 files changed, 19 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/x86/entry/vdso/vclock_gettime.c b/arch/x86/entry/vdso/vclock_gettime.c
index 98c7d12..7c9db26 100644
--- a/arch/x86/entry/vdso/vclock_gettime.c
+++ b/arch/x86/entry/vdso/vclock_gettime.c
@@ -144,6 +144,13 @@ notrace static int do_hres(clockid_t clk, struct timespec *ts)
struct vgtod_ts *base = >od->basetime[clk];
u64 cycles, last, sec, ns;
unsigned int seq;
+ u32 mult = gtod->mult;
+ u32 shift = gtod->shift;
+
+ if (clk == C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W) {
+ mult = gtod->raw_mult;
+ shift = gtod->raw_shift;
+ }
do {
seq = gtod_read_begin(gtod);
@@ -153,8 +160,8 @@ notrace static int do_hres(clockid_t clk, struct timespec *ts)
if (unlikely((s64)cycles < 0))
return vdso_fallback_gettime(clk, ts);
if (cycles > last)
- ns += (cycles - last) * gtod->mult;
- ns >>= gtod->shift;
+ ns += (cycles - last) * mult;
+ ns >>= shift;
sec = base->sec;
} while (unlikely(gtod_read_retry(gtod, seq)));
diff --git a/arch/x86/entry/vsyscall/vsyscall_gtod.c b/arch/x86/entry/vsyscall/vsyscall_gtod.c
index cfcdba0..a967f02 100644
--- a/arch/x86/entry/vsyscall/vsyscall_gtod.c
+++ b/arch/x86/entry/vsyscall/vsyscall_gtod.c
@@ -46,11 +46,17 @@ void update_vsyscall(struct timekeeper *tk)
vdata->mask = tk->tkr_mono.mask;
vdata->mult = tk->tkr_mono.mult;
vdata->shift = tk->tkr_mono.shift;
+ vdata->raw_mult = tk->tkr_raw.mult;
+ vdata->raw_shift = tk->tkr_raw.shift;
base = &vdata->basetime[CLOCK_REALTIME];
base->sec = tk->xtime_sec;
base->nsec = tk->tkr_mono.xtime_nsec;
+ base = &vdata->basetime[C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W];
+ base->sec = tk->raw_sec;
+ base->nsec = tk->tkr_raw.xtime_nsec;
+
base = &vdata->basetime[CLOCK_TAI];
base->sec = tk->xtime_sec + (s64)tk->tai_offset;
base->nsec = tk->tkr_mono.xtime_nsec;
di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/vgtod.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/vgtod.h
index 913a133..f65c42b 100644
--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/vgtod.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/vgtod.h
@@ -28,7 +28,8 @@ struct vgtod_ts {
};
#define VGTOD_BASES (CLOCK_TAI + 1)
-#define VGTOD_HRES (BIT(CLOCK_REALTIME) | BIT(CLOCK_MONOTONIC) | BIT(CLOCK_TAI))
+#define VGTOD_HRES (BIT(CLOCK_REALTIME) | BIT(CLOCK_MONOTONIC) | \
+ BIT(C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W) | BIT(CLOCK_TAI))
#define VGTOD_COARSE (BIT(CLOCK_REALTIME_COARSE) | BIT(CLOCK_MONOTONIC_COARSE))
/*
@@ -43,6 +44,8 @@ struct vsyscall_gtod_data {
u64 mask;
u32 mult;
u32 shift;
+ u32 raw_mult;
+ u32 raw_shift;
struct vgtod_ts basetime[VGTOD_BASES];
